🧀 Cheesy Broccoli Vegetable Casserole
📝 Description
Cheesy Broccoli Vegetable Casserole is a comforting, oven-baked dish packed with tender broccoli, mixed vegetables, and a rich, creamy cheese sauce. It’s perfect as a hearty side dish or a satisfying vegetarian main course. This casserole is family-friendly, easy to prepare, and ideal for weeknight dinners, potlucks, or holiday meals.
⏱️ Prep & Cook Time
-
Prep Time: 15 minutes
-
Cook Time: 30–35 minutes
-
Total Time: 45–50 minutes
🍽️ Servings
-
Serves: 6 people
🧾 Ingredients
Vegetables
-
3 cups broccoli florets (fresh or frozen)
-
1 cup carrots, diced
-
1 cup cauliflower florets
-
½ cup bell peppers, chopped (optional)
Cheese Sauce
-
2 tablespoons butter
-
2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
-
1½ cups milk (whole or low-fat)
-
1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
-
½ cup shredded mozzarella cheese
-
½ teaspoon garlic powder
-
¼ teaspoon black pepper
-
Salt to taste
Topping (Optional but Recommended)
-
½ cup breadcrumbs or crushed crackers
-
1 tablespoon melted butter
-
2 tablespoons grated Parmesan cheese
👩🍳 Instructions
-
Preheat Oven
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C). Lightly grease a baking dish. -
Prepare Vegetables
Steam or blanch broccoli, carrots, and cauliflower for 3–4 minutes until slightly tender. Drain well. -
Make the Cheese Sauce
-
Melt butter in a saucepan over medium heat.
-
Whisk in flour and cook for 1 minute.
-
Slowly add milk while whisking until smooth.
-
Cook until thickened, then reduce heat.
-
Stir in cheddar, mozzarella, garlic powder, salt, and pepper until melted.
-
-
Assemble Casserole
Combine vegetables with cheese sauce and spread evenly in the baking dish. -
Add Topping
Mix breadcrumbs, melted butter, and Parmesan. Sprinkle over casserole. -
Bake
Bake uncovered for 30–35 minutes, or until bubbly and golden on top. -
Serve
Let rest for 5 minutes before serving.
💡 Notes & Tips
-
Use frozen vegetables for convenience—just thaw and drain well.
-
For extra protein, add cooked chicken, tofu, or chickpeas.
-
Swap cheddar for Gruyère or Monterey Jack for a flavor twist.
-
To make it gluten-free, use gluten-free flour and breadcrumbs.
-
Avoid watery casserole by draining vegetables thoroughly.

❓ Q & A
Q: Can I make this casserole ahead of time?
A: Yes! Assemble it, cover, and refrigerate for up to 24 hours before baking.
Q: Can I freeze Cheesy Broccoli Casserole?
A: Yes, freeze unbaked or baked for up to 2 months. Thaw overnight before reheating.
Q: How do I make it healthier?
A: Use low-fat cheese, skim milk, and add more vegetables.
Q: What can I serve with this casserole?
A: It pairs well with grilled chicken, baked fish, rice, or a fresh green salad.
Q: Can I make it vegan?
A: Yes—use plant-based butter, milk, and vegan cheese alternatives.
